A RARE CARVED YAOZHOU CELADON JAR FIVE DYNASTIES PERIOD (AD 907-960) The tapering, bulbous body is well carved with five large peony blossoms rising from lotus petals below, each reserved against and framed by a large rounded petal. The large petals overlap further petals set between them, all with incised details and all below a double bow-string band on the shoulder. The jar is covered in a glaze of soft sea-green tone. 5 7/8 in. (15 cm.) wide, Japanese wood box Provenance Sen Shu Tey, Tokyo.
